Start your training journey on the right paw with these helpful suggestions. Firstly, make sure your buddy is well-socialized. A well-socialized dog will tend to of succeeding in training.
Secondly, define your rules. Consistency is essential. Dogs thrive on routine and understanding what is expected of them. Use treats and praise to inspire good behavior.
Last but not least, be patient and persistent. Training takes time and effort. Don't get defeated if your dog doesn't learn instantly.

Understanding Your Dog's Tail Wags
A dog's tail is more than just a cute appendage; it's a complex communication tool that can reveal tons of information about how your furry friend is feeling. While a wagging tail often signifies happiness, the rhythm of the get more info wag and its position can offer deeper insights into your dog's mood. A slow, gentle wag may indicate contentment, while a fast, vigorous wag could signal excitement. Pay attention to the whole context – your dog's body language, facial expressions, and vocalizations – for a more accurate decoding of their tail wags.
- Consider, a wagging tail held high might imply a feeling of superiority, while a low, tucked tail could show anxiety.
By learning to read your dog's tail wags, you can improve your bond and develop a deeper understanding of their needs and emotions.
